District Overview
Located at 510 S. Highland Avenue in Tucson, Arizona, Highland Free School is an active independent charter district operating a single campus in a vibrant, large-city setting. Serving students from Kindergarten through sixth grade, this fully operational public district provides a focused primary education framework designed to nurture young learners during their foundational academic years. As its own local education agency, the district offers families in the Tucson metropolitan area an engaging alternative to traditional public schooling, centered on community connection and elementary growth.
Highland Free School stands out for its remarkably intimate learning environment, enrolling a close-knit student body of just 31 children across all grade levels. The campus is staffed by six full-time equivalent teachers, resulting in an exceptionally low student-to-teacher ratio of approximately five to one that enables highly personalized instruction and tailored academic support. Reflecting the rich diversity of its urban setting, the student population includes Hispanic, White, Black, and multiracial children. For parents seeking a small-school dynamic and researchers examining low-ratio charter models, Highland Free School offers a compelling example of small-scale, student-focused elementary education in southern Arizona.

Demographics
District Demographics Data Table
| Demographic | Student Count |
|---|---|
| White | 11 |
| Hispanic | 12 |
| Black | 4 |
| Two or More | 4 |
